    This course addresses a set of prominent policy issues where economics is at their core. We'll explore their origins as policy matters, the underlying data and evidence, and what policy levers are available to deal with them. Each lecture will be taught by a different subject matter expert.

    Through a multidisciplinary look at American history, current events, prospective futures, and selective denials, we’ll explore prospects for healing our diverse narratives and growing together as more fully human beings—for our own sakes, and for our kids and grandkids, and theirs.
